Researchers have introduced ‘NeuM’, a cutting-edge technology for labeling neurons, allowing for detailed observation of neuronal structures and real-time monitoring of changes. This innovation holds significant promise in the battle against neurodegenerative diseases such as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s, and stroke. These conditions are characterized by the gradual deterioration of nerve cells, necessitating precise labeling technologies to visualize changes in neurons under various conditions.
Developed by a research team led by Dr. Kim Yun Kyung from KIST in collaboration with Professor Chang Young-Tae’s team, NeuM selectively labels neuronal membranes, enabling high-resolution imaging and long-term tracking of living neurons. Unlike current labeling technologies, NeuM utilizes fluorescent probes that bind to neuronal membranes, emitting fluorescent signals upon excitation. This technology allows for detailed observation of neuronal structures and tracking of changes over an extended period.
With the ability to distinguish between aging and degenerating neurons, NeuM is poised to enhance our understanding of degenerative brain disorders and aid in the development of effective treatments. Dr. Kim emphasized the importance of NeuM in elucidating disease mechanisms and expressed plans to further refine the technology for more precise neuronal analysis. This groundbreaking research, published in Angewandte Chemie International Edition, was supported by the Ministry of Science and ICT and the Dementia Overcoming Project.
